is there a way to see when was a surten person was on the last time on a chat if i have there exact name they used before?
if so how?

Some networks and/or channels have a !seen command available.
Usual usage is: !seen <nick>

Additionallly, you might try /whowas <nick>

Neither of these are guaranteed.

If the network in question features NickServ, it may reply a "last seen time" (though in fact it's the last time that nick was visible to the services: presuming the nick is registered to nickserv, and idenified successfully) - Try a: /msg nickserv info FriendsNickname
